Dave Stevens is a full-time IT Instructor at the University of Hawai’i Kapi’olani Community College, specializing in Cyber Security. Before becoming U.H. faculty, he spent 20 years as an IT consultant / contractor. His IT experience covers embedded development for cryptographic microprocessors, cyber security, cloud infrastructure architecture, project management, programming, database administration, networking, and website development. Recently he served as the University of Hawai’i Community College (UHCC) System Cyber Security Coordinator for a Dept. of Labor grant funding Cyber Security curriculum development, Cyber Workforce development, and Veterans outreach. He is a senior member of the IEEE, and is a Certified Information System Security Professional (CISSP).

The Society of Professional Journalists works to improve and protect journalism. SPJ promotes the free flow of information vital to a well-informed citizenry; works to inspire and educate the next generation of journalists; and protects First Amendment guarantees of freedom of speech and press.
